Full Nutrition Comparison (per 100g)

NutrientApples, Dried, Sulfured, UncookedBabyfood, Cereal, High Protein, With Apple And Orange, DryDifference
Calories243.0 kcal374.0 kcal-131.0 kcal
Protein0.9 g25.4 g-24.5 g
Total Fat0.3 g6.5 g-6.2 g
Saturated Fat0.1 g1.0 g-0.9 g
Carbs65.9 g57.6 g+8.3 g
Fiber8.7 g7.1 g+1.6 g
Sugar57.2 g--
Sodium87.0 mg104.0 mg-17.0 mg
Cholesterol0.0 mg0.0 mg0.0 mg
Potassium450.0 mg1330.0 mg-880.0 mg
Vitamin C3.9 mg3.1 mg+0.8 mg
Calcium14.0 mg751.0 mg-737.0 mg
Iron1.4 mg47.5 mg-46.1 mg
